Output 3dc53ebeb6012f0d8f831d369d14512daff1683d1f8c9654ffaf1709f49eef8c:0

value
20173625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e77052000329fefbf75942bfe99872204ebc7a2 OP_EQUAL
address
34U6mxKXn89edwasXc2vBYvP55pvdR6StD
transaction
3dc53ebeb6012f0d8f831d369d14512daff1683d1f8c9654ffaf1709f49eef8c
spent
true